BREVARD COUNTY, FLORIDA – The Brevard County Sheriff’s Office is seeking WATCH: Brevard County Sheriff’s Office ‘Fishing for Fugitives’ Seeks Suspect Colleen Rebecca Johnson in the latest edition of “Fishing for Fugitives,” as Sheriff Wayne Ivey comes to you from Camp Holly in Melbourne.

In this episode, Sheriff Ivey is seeking Colleen Rebecca Johnson who is wanted for:

■ Violation of Community Control REF Possession of Methamphetamine.

■ Violation of Probation REF Possession of Fentanyl, Possession of Methamphetamine.

Sheriff Ivey says Johnson is known to be in the “waters of the Melbourne area” and was last “hooked” on January 4, 2021.

Johnson has  no bond.

“If you’re the ‘Catch of the Day,’ you know what to do, turn yourself in and do the right thing – don’t make our Fugitive Unit come to get you. Because if you don’t turn yourself in, I promise you, they aren’t far from your house,” said Sheriff Ivey.
